FORT MYERS, Fla. — If you’re making outdoor plans this weekend, Saturday looks like the better day than Sunday. Storms will be more isolated on the first day of the weekend before more moisture returns for Sunday. It’ll be a steamy Saturday however, with highs soaring into the mid-90s. Sunday’s slightly rain-cooled temperatures will climb into the low to mid-90s. Overnight lows each evening will dip into the mid-70s. Saturday is the 12th anniversary of the devastating landfall of Hurricane Charley, but the tropics are inactive on Aug. 13 this year.
